Inside story of settling

Please understand that bank has not done a charity by settling your account for less. Bank settles only for a simple reason that they want to recover whatever they can from you. After all, something is better than nothing. Moreover, bank is not going to forgive you for your non-payment as they will send a report to CIBIL stating that this person has settled his loan amounting XXX by paying XYZ amount. Please mark ‘SETTLED’ in front of his name.  Now, if a person has not repaid the amount in full, his status will continue to show settled in CIBIL’s report which in itself is a negative sign for you and will affect you in future.

Consequences of settling

Two years later, Arvind applied for a car loan and his application was rejected. When he enquired, he got the reason that his name is there in the defaulter’s list of CIBIL and that he cannot get loan for 7 years commencing the date of settlement. Now, after 7 years, even if his name will be removed but still he will have to face hardships in getting a loan because of low credit score. However, it is possible to improve your credit score but it takes time.

Conclusion

A settled status marked by CIBIL is indicative of the fact that you must have failed to meet your debt obligations in past and that you have not paid your debts in full. Lenders consider this as a negative sign and are reluctant to offer loans to such persons. If you plan or foresee to apply for any loan or credit card in future, then avoid settling your account.
